More meat from Rain Shadow Meats

Yesterday I had lunch at the Melrose Market with Tim. Could not pass up the meat on display at Rain Shadow Meats. I walked out with Chorizo sausages, 2 kinds of Italian sausage and a sampling of their beef short ribs. The Italian sausage and the short ribs will be tonight’s dinner.
